Whatever the grub on the menu for today to forage taproots that stick in my way I'll dig and gather the crop incessantly when the season's fruits are scarce my senses say build fat stores accumulate for inclement conditions ode to seasonal change renditions I'll hunt, unearth a savory nut return loyally to its burial as other resources are drained probably a mark of one who goes insane accorded only one choice in life..to remain but I move on in this buried and unearthed life have witnessed years of plenty and undo strife have experienced the death of winter chill swift salvage means allows me an even keel... so hunt I will for a savory nut from the vantage point of my town hut. |
